Adding Texture
As mentioned previously, rollers are available in various naps for applying paint, texture, or both. Rollers can be achieved from many materials, with respect to the desired effect. Short nap rollers are perfect for applying paint to smooth surfaces, while longer nap rollers are good for getting yourself into hard textures. Rollers may be used to apply sand, drywall compound, or any number of textures commonly when combined paint. Some rollers are even created for specific uses, for example painting a textured ceiling.
